TL;DR
- Android 16 QPR3 Beta 2 makes a previously experimental Recents menu change official.
- Users can no longer save images locally or open them directly in Lens from the Recents screen, with options now limited to just copy or share.
- The change quietly downgrades a helpful multitasking feature that many Android users may not have even realized existed.
Android 16 QPR3 Beta 2 is now rolling out, and it officially brings several bug fixes and stability improvements. However, the update is also rolling out with a subtle downgrade for the Recents menu that we first spotted back in the Android Canary 2512 update.
